Maven自定义/多个web.xml

时间:2015-01-12 17:13:52

标签: maven netbeans web-inf

我决定自定义web.xml,因为应用程序将部署在多个URL(内部/外部面向)中。我有一个custom-resources文件夹,并决定将自定义web.xml放在那里。

但是我无法将其放入WEB-INF文件夹中。我创建了两个资源,一个包含,一个包含web.xml。我尝试过放置$ {project.build.directory} / WEB-INF或WEB-INF或..

我使用的是netbeans 8.它使用Maven 3.我不确定netbeans是否正在调整封面下的内容。

 <resource>
   <directory>custom-resources/dev</directory>
   <includes>
     <include>**/web.xml</include>
   </includes>
   <targetPath>..</targetPath>
 </resource>

1 个答案:

答案 0 :(得分:0)

我无法完成此操作,因为自动将所有自定义资源复制到WEB-INF / classes。决定使用copy-resources插件。该过程为explained here。如果有人有不同的解决方案,请发布。